Replacement Guttering Costs
The cost of gutter replacement usually includes both the supply and labor costs. The latter will depend on the scaffolding required and the cost of the material used.
The average labour cost for installing guttering ranges from PS200 to PS300. This is the average daily cost that gutter installers typically charge. It takes a day to install gutters.
Material
Guttering can be found in a variety of materials including plastic, aluminium and copper. The type of material you select will determine how long your guttering will last and how much it costs. Plastic, on average, will only last about 10 years, while metal guttering can last up to 30 years and is greater durability in harsh weather conditions - meaning you're less likely to need replacements.
The best guttering for your home will depend on your budget and whether you want something simple and inexpensive or a more durable choice that is more expensive. This latter option can be more expensive, but it will save you money on repairs in the future, and will ensure that your gutters look beautiful on your house.
The size of your home will also affect the overall costs of the project. A larger house will cost more to install than a smaller one because there is more guttering needed. A steeper roof may require a special guttering system and scaffolding could be needed to install it.
Guttering is sold by the millimetre, and a complete length of guttering will cost according to. A standard half-round gutter made of plastic will cost approximately PS2 per metre, and copper costs about PS30 per metre. The thickness of the guttering, and the kind of downpipe that comes with it will also impact the cost.

Downpipes
Guttering permits water to be able to flow off the roof into the downpipes, from which it can then be safely diverted away from your property. This is crucial if your home is prone to dampness as without guttering, water could fall directly onto the walls and cause them to decay. Guttering needs to be cleaned regularly to ensure there are no blockages, which could occur when leaves and other debris become stuck in them.
If you are looking to replace your gutters you should consider the benefits of choosing metal-based systems over plastic. While plastic is more affordable, is susceptible to cracking or break in extreme weather conditions. Metal-based systems are a more sturdy option, and aluminium is particularly renowned for its strength and durability. It can be crafted to look similar to cast iron. This would suit older homes or properties that are more period.

Fascia
The fascia board is a part of the roofline that sits at the point where the roof meets the outer wall. It gives the roofline an polished appearance and also supports and carries guttering. Fascia boards can become rotted if they are exposed to humidity.
It is recommended to replace the fascia boards with guttering. This will ensure safety and quality and is less expensive than fixing damaged or rotten fascia boards. It is best to hire a professional to do this type of work. They must be certified and have the proper equipment.
